Joanne Tabellija-Murphy

National Director, Public Affairs, Walmart

Joanne Tabellija-Murphy joined Walmart in 2013 and is responsible for building partnerships and strategies that advance stakeholder advocacy, and transform social change building trust in communities where the company’s businesses are located. As an external affairs professional on key socio-economic issues, she grows the business in areas such as community affairs and public affairs, internal policy and public policy issues, diverse societal and employee issues. She develops strategies, builds coalitions and spearheads measurable pathways to do business with diverse stakeholders and key influencers. She is a consultant for the company, lending expertise in growing diverse and emerging customer bases. Joanne is an advisor on the Walmart Trust and Transparency steering committee.

In support of Walmart external diverse stakeholders, Joanne created and leads the newly launched LeadHERship Coalition. The Coalition, in partnership with Working Mother, is an alliance of companies and nonprofits committed to addressing issues that impede diverse women’s progress. Joanne holds seats on several board of directors and advisory boards including WIPP, Enterprising Women Magazine, OCA National and Gold House Book Club, and has held board seats as chair and director for many non-profits and not-for-profits. Most recently, she is Chair of the OCA National Business Advisory Council, leading its strategy focused on shared value for its members and the organization. She is often lauded by civic and nonprofit leaders for her strategic thinking and communications prowess, serving as a role model to many Walmart associates.

She has held prior roles in corporate and public service including Brand Marketing, Marketing, Supplier Diversity, Training/Development, Court Magistrate and Finance. Previous employers include MillerCoors, Coors Brewing Company, McKesson, The Baily Company/Arby’s, The InnBetween, City of Florence/State of Oregon.
